AUGUSTA, Ga. — As the sun rises on April 9, 2025, golf enthusiasts prepare for the annual Par-3 Contest, a beloved warm-up ahead of the prestigious Masters Tournament. Scheduled for Wednesday, this event allows PGA Tour players to practice alongside their families, creating a festive atmosphere before the competition.

The Par-3 course, established in 1960, features a nine-hole layout that winds around DeSoto Springs Pond and Ike’s Pond. Among its notable holes, the shortest is a mere 90 yards, while the longest stretches 155 yards. Despite the relaxed vibe of the contest, no player has ever won both the Par-3 Contest and the Masters in the same year, although 12 golfers have accomplished this feat in separate years.

One player to watch this year is Rickie Fowler. Despite finishing tied for 30th in the tournament last year, Fowler is known for his impressive performance in past Par-3 events, including a hole-in-one in 2018.

This year’s Par-3 contest promises to be a breezy and relaxed lead-in to the high-stakes golf of the Masters, showcasing camaraderie among the players before the tournament’s serious undertones take over. The official proceedings for the Masters will commence on Thursday with golf legends Jack Nicklaus, Gary Player, and Tom Watson serving as honorary starters. The first tee time is set for 7:25 a.m. ET.

In addition to tradition, the Par-3 event has its own records. The original low score was set by Art Wall Jr. in 1965 at 7-under par, a record only matched by Gay Brewer in 1973. This longstanding mark was surpassed by Jimmy Walker in 2016, who scored an impressive 8-under par. In the last decade, Walker, along with Matt Wallace in 2019 and Tom Hoge in 2023, has registered holes-in-one during the warm-up.
